WAR has been declared on irresponsible dog owners who allow their pets to foul the streets of Shaldon.

Parish councillors have had so many complaints about the mess, they commissioned a portable notice board which is being moved to different troublespots appealing for residents to help stamp out the fouling.

The campaign message is ‘pick up dog poo please’.

And they have also recruited a volunteer to train as a dog warden.

‘The problem seems to be getting worse – we have had a flood of complaints about dog mess on the pavements, and on the King George V playing field,’ said Cllr Chris Clarance.

‘The council decided that something had to be done, and the A-frame board will be chained up around the village to spread the message.
